Introduction to Balayage

Balayage has become one of the most sought-after hair coloring techniques in recent years, gaining popularity for its natural, sun-kissed look. The word "balayage" comes from the French word "balayer," meaning "to sweep," which describes the freehand technique used to apply color to the hair. Unlike traditional foil highlights, balayage creates a more subtle, blended effect with softer lines and less maintenance. Why Choose Balayage?

Balayage is widely favored for several reasons. One of the most appealing aspects of this coloring technique is its natural, sun-kissed effect. Because the color is applied by hand, with no harsh lines or foils, it creates a seamless blend that mimics the way the sun lightens hair naturally. This results in a more organic, less obvious contrast between your natural color and the highlights.

Another benefit of balayage is the low-maintenance nature of the style. Traditional highlights often require frequent touch-ups as the hair grows, but balayage grows out beautifully without creating noticeable roots. This makes it an excellent choice for those with busy schedules or who don't want to spend a lot of time at the salon.

Balayage also works well for a variety of hair types, lengths, and textures. Whether your hair is straight, wavy, or curly, balayage can be customized to suit your unique needs. The technique can also be tailored to different shades, from subtle blonde highlights to rich caramel or bold red tones, making it a versatile option for all individuals.

Balayage vs. Traditional Highlights

While both balayage and traditional highlights involve adding lighter colors to the hair, there are key differences between the two techniques. Traditional highlights are applied using foils, which isolate the hair sections that are being lightened. This results in a more uniform, evenly distributed color pattern, with distinct lines where the color begins and ends. Traditional highlights typically require more maintenance, as the roots become more noticeable as the hair grows out.

In contrast, balayage is a freehand technique that creates a more natural-looking result. The color is painted onto the hair, blending seamlessly from the roots to the tips. Because there are no foils used, balayage doesn't produce the same defined lines that traditional highlights do, creating a more subtle effect. Additionally, balayage grows out more gracefully, with no harsh line between the colored and natural hair, making it ideal for people who prefer a low-maintenance style.

How to Maintain Balayage Hair Color

One of the biggest advantages of balayage is its low-maintenance nature, but like all hair coloring techniques, some upkeep is required to keep your hair looking fresh and vibrant. Here are some tips for maintaining your balayage hair color:

  • Use Sulfate-Free Shampoo: Sulfates can strip color from the hair, causing it to fade more quickly. Using a sulfate-free shampoo will help preserve the vibrancy of your balayage.
  • Deep Condition Regularly: Balayage can sometimes leave hair feeling dry or brittle, especially if lightener is used. Regularly deep conditioning your hair will help keep it healthy and shiny.
  • Avoid Excessive Heat Styling: Excessive heat can damage hair and cause the color to fade. If you must style your hair with heat tools, always use a heat protectant spray.
  • Get Regular Touch-Ups: While balayage grows out more gracefully than traditional highlights, it's still important to schedule touch-ups every few months to keep your color looking fresh.
